A square plate maintained at 95 ° C experiences a force of 10.5
N when forced air at 25 ° C flows over it at a velocity of 30 m / s
. Assuming the flow to be turbulent and using Colburn analogy
calculate ( a ) the heat transfer coefficient and ( b ) the heat
loss from the plate surface . Properties of air at 60 ° C are : p =
1.06 kg / m³ , c = 1.005 kJ / kgk , v = 18.97 x 10-6 m² / s , Pr =
0.696
